Motor Assembly, DC, Stepping had quit working which caused the loover on the front of the air conditioner to remain open

Main problem was removing the cowling from the LG head unit as I had no instructions on how to do it. I had watched the previous technicians that had worked on the unit remove it. Once the cowling is removed all that needs done is remove the 2 mounting screws and unplug the old motor, plug in the new motor and remount it with the 2 screws
... Read more. Then the cowling has to be reinstalled.
